What is the answer to the following problem 2/3+5/9

Respuesta :

zdudezy zdudezy
  • 15-08-2019

Answer:

11/9 or 1 2/9

Step-by-step explanation:

2/3 multiples by 3 in both the numerator and denominator is equal to 6/9. 6/9 plus 5/9 is 11/9. you want to make sure the denominator is the same before adding or subtracting
